The National Transportation Safety Board is urging government agencies to study 68 U.S. bridges frequented by ocean-going vessels and constructed before current risk standards were established. The list includes two in Oregon: the St. Johns Bridge, built in 1931, and the Astoria-Megler Bridge, built in 1966. Find a link to the full story in our bio.
